- Timing: Plant onion sets in early spring or fall, depending on your location and climate.
- Soil: Onions thrive in loose, well-drained, fertile soil with a good pH level (around 6.0-7.0).
- Sunlight: Choose a location that receives at least 6-8 hours of direct sunlight daily.
- Orientation: Ensure the pointy end of the set faces upwards.
- Depth: Dig holes about 1-2 inches deep and plant the sets so the top is just at the soil surface.
- Spacing: Space the sets 4-6 inches apart in the row.
- Mulch: Apply a layer of mulch (straw or leaves) around the plants to retain moisture and suppress weeds.
- Watering: Keep the soil consistently moist, especially during dry periods.
- Fertilizing: Amend the soil with compost or a balanced fertilizer before planting.
- Weeding: Regularly remove weeds to prevent competition for nutrients and water.
- Harvest: Harvest the onions when the foliage starts to yellow and fall over, indicating maturity.
